Situated on a rise on a S-facing slope that is on the lower slopes of Dough Mountain and on the N side of Glenfarne valley. This is a grass and reed-covered circular area (int. diam 39.5m E-W; 37m N-S) defined by an earth and stone bank (Wth 4.8m; int. H 0.25m; ext. H 0.7m) with bushes. There is no visible fosse and the original entrance is not identified. It is overlain by a N-S field bank towards the perimeter at W. Rath (LE008-018----) is c. 200m to the NW.
The above description is derived from 'The Archaeological Inventory of County Leitrim' compiled by Michael J. Moore (Dublin: Stationery Office, 2003). In certain instances the entries have been revised and updated in the light of recent research.
